当前位置:首页 > 程序系统 > 正文内容

php免费开发工具,PHP开发者必备,免费开发工具大推荐

wzgly2个月前 (06-15)程序系统1
PHP免费开发工具包括多种资源,如集成开发环境(IDEs)如Visual Studio Code、Sublime Text,代码编辑器如Notepad++,以及在线代码编辑器如CodePen和JSFiddle,还有版本控制系统如Git,以及本地服务器模拟工具如XAMPP和WAMP,这些工具支持PHP开发人员编写、测试和部署PHP应用程序,无需额外费用。

PHP免费开发工具大盘点:助你高效编程无忧愁

用户解答: 嗨,大家好!最近我在学习PHP编程,想找一些免费的开发工具来辅助我的学习,但是市面上工具太多了,不知道该选哪个,有没有什么推荐的免费PHP开发工具呢?希望大佬们能给我一些建议,谢谢!

我将从以下几个为大家详细介绍一些免费的PHP开发工具,帮助大家更好地选择适合自己的工具。

php免费开发工具

一:代码编辑器

  1. Visual Studio Code:这款编辑器功能强大,支持多种编程语言,插件丰富,可以满足PHP开发的各种需求。
  2. Sublime Text:轻量级、速度快,界面简洁,是很多PHP开发者的首选。
  3. Atom:由GitHub开发,具有高度可定制性,适合喜欢自己配置开发环境的开发者。

二:集成开发环境(IDE)

  1. PhpStorm:虽然不是免费的,但是有30天的免费试用期,它提供了强大的代码提示、调试和重构功能,非常适合PHP开发。
  2. Eclipse PDT:基于Eclipse平台,支持PHP开发,具有代码提示、调试等功能。
  3. NetBeans:支持多种编程语言,包括PHP,界面友好,适合初学者。

三:版本控制系统

  1. Git:免费的版本控制系统,支持分布式版本管理,是PHP开发中常用的工具。
  2. SVN:集中式版本控制系统,适合团队协作,也支持PHP项目开发。
  3. Mercurial:另一种分布式版本控制系统,与Git类似,但更注重易用性。

四:调试工具

  1. Xdebug:PHP调试器,可以提供详细的调试信息,帮助开发者快速定位问题。
  2. XAMPP:一款免费的PHP开发环境,包含Apache、MySQL、PHP和Perl,方便开发者快速搭建开发环境。
  3. WAMP:类似XAMPP,但主要针对Windows用户,包含Apache、MySQL、PHP和Perl。

五:代码质量检查工具

  1. PHPStan:静态代码分析工具,可以帮助开发者发现潜在的问题,提高代码质量。
  2. PHP Mess Detector:代码质量检查工具,可以检测代码中的错误和潜在问题。
  3. PHP CodeSniffer:代码风格检查工具,可以帮助开发者保持一致的代码风格。

通过以上介绍,相信大家对PHP免费开发工具有了一定的了解,选择适合自己的工具,可以让你的PHP开发之路更加顺畅,这些工具只是辅助工具,真正提高编程能力还需要不断学习和实践,希望这篇文章能对大家有所帮助!

其他相关扩展阅读资料参考文献:

PHP免费开发工具深度解析

PHP开发工具的的介绍

随着PHP开发领域的不断发展,越来越多的开发者投身于PHP的开发工作,为了提高开发效率和代码质量,选择一款合适的PHP开发工具显得尤为重要,本文将为您介绍一些免费的PHP开发工具,帮助您快速入门,提升开发效率。

php免费开发工具

一:集成开发环境(IDE)类工具

  1. Visual Studio Code(VS Code) VS Code是一款轻量级的代码编辑器,支持PHP开发,它具有丰富的插件生态系统,可以安装各种PHP插件以增强其功能,VS Code还提供了代码自动补全、语法高亮、调试等功能,是PHP开发者的首选工具之一。
  2. PhpStorm PhpStorm是JetBrains公司开发的集成开发环境(IDE),专为PHP开发者设计,它提供了丰富的功能,如智能代码补全、实时语法检查、代码调试等,虽然PhpStorm是收费的,但社区版提供了大部分基础功能,对于初学者来说已经足够使用。

二:PHP框架与CMS工具

  1. Laravel框架 Laravel是一个流行的PHP框架,它提供了丰富的功能和工具,如身份验证、数据库迁移、路由等,Laravel框架有助于开发者快速构建健壮的应用程序,提高开发效率。
  2. WordPress WordPress是一个流行的内容管理系统(CMS),它基于PHP开发,WordPress提供了丰富的插件和主题生态系统,可以方便地构建各种类型的网站,对于网站开发人员来说,WordPress是一个很好的选择。

三:调试与测试工具

  1. Xdebug Xdebug是一个用于调试PHP代码的插件,它可以帮助开发者跟踪代码的执行过程,查找代码中的错误和性能问题,使用Xdebug可以提高代码质量和开发效率。
  2. Behat Behat是一个PHP的行为驱动开发(BDD)测试框架,它允许开发者为应用程序编写可读的测试场景,确保代码的质量和稳定性,Behat是PHP开发者进行自动化测试的好帮手。

四:版本控制工具

Git是一种分布式版本控制系统,广泛用于PHP开发,Git可以帮助开发者管理代码的版本,记录每次代码的修改和更新,使用Git可以方便地协作开发,提高团队的效率,许多IDE和Git都进行了集成,方便开发者在IDE中直接使用Git功能。

php免费开发工具

选择合适的PHP开发工具对于提高开发效率和代码质量至关重要,本文介绍了集成开发环境(IDE)类工具、PHP框架与CMS工具、调试与测试工具以及版本控制工具等方面的免费开发工具,希望这些工具能够帮助您更好地进行PHP开发工作。

扫描二维码推送至手机访问。

版权声明:本文由码界编程网发布,如需转载请注明出处。

本文链接:http://b2b.dropc.cn/cxxt/6103.html

分享给朋友:

“php免费开发工具,PHP开发者必备,免费开发工具大推荐” 的相关文章

form表单提交数据怎么拿到返回,如何接收并处理form表单提交的返回数据

form表单提交数据怎么拿到返回,如何接收并处理form表单提交的返回数据

在使用form表单提交数据时,获取返回值的方法通常有以下几种:,1. **GET请求**:如果表单使用GET方法提交,可以直接在URL后跟参数获取返回值,服务器响应后,通常会在浏览器地址栏显示返回数据。,2. **POST请求**:对于POST请求,可以在JavaScript中使用AJAX(如jQu...

html5和xhtml,HTML5与XHTML,现代网页开发的双剑合璧

html5和xhtml,HTML5与XHTML,现代网页开发的双剑合璧

HTML5和XHTML是两种网页设计语言,HTML5是最新版本的HTML,它提供了更丰富的功能,如视频和音频支持,离线存储等,XHTML是基于XML的,它要求标签必须正确闭合,元素必须小写,并且属性必须使用引号,两者都是构建网页的基础,但HTML5更加灵活和强大。 嗨,大家好!我最近在学习前端开发...

网上报名学编程靠谱吗,网络编程学习,安全可靠的选择?

网上报名学编程靠谱吗,网络编程学习,安全可靠的选择?

网上报名学编程是一种便捷的学习方式,但靠谱与否取决于多个因素,选择正规、口碑良好的平台,了解课程内容与师资力量是关键,个人自律和持续学习也非常重要,对于有一定基础或自学能力强的学习者,网上编程学习是可行的选择,但若为零基础或希望获得更系统化的学习,建议结合线上与线下资源,确保学习效果。 嗨,我最近...

lookup函数的使用,高效查找技巧,深入解析lookup函数的应用

lookup函数的使用,高效查找技巧,深入解析lookup函数的应用

lookup函数是一种在Excel等电子表格软件中用于查找特定值并返回对应数据的函数,它通过在表格中搜索指定值,然后返回该值所在行的指定列的值,使用lookup函数时,需指定查找值、查找范围以及返回值所在列,lookup函数支持两种查找方式:精确查找和近似查找,精确查找要求查找值与表格中的值完全匹配...

php软件是什么,PHP软件,解析与运用指南

php软件是什么,PHP软件,解析与运用指南

PHP软件是一种开源的、服务器端脚本语言,主要用于网页开发,它允许开发者创建动态内容,处理表单数据,与数据库交互,以及构建交互式网站,PHP易于学习,支持多种数据库和操作系统,广泛用于网页开发领域,是全球最受欢迎的编程语言之一。PHP软件是什么——揭秘背后的技术与应用 真实用户解答: 嗨,我最近...

基于html5的毕业设计,HTML5技术驱动下的创新毕业设计实践

基于html5的毕业设计,HTML5技术驱动下的创新毕业设计实践

本毕业设计基于HTML5技术,旨在探讨其在现代网页设计中的应用与发展,通过分析HTML5的新特性,如离线存储、多媒体支持等,展示其在提升网页性能、用户体验方面的优势,结合实际案例,探讨HTML5在响应式设计、移动端开发等方面的应用,为网页设计与开发提供新的思路和方法。 嗨,我是一名即将毕业的大学生...